Since someone asked, yeah, when we decide on a date I'll ask people to sign up by posting their battle.net ID. At some sign-up cut-off, I'll take those signed up and put them in a bracket generator, post bracket. On the day of we'll have a check-in time, either via a website or logging into an IRC channel etc., something (Krassus offered a voice chat server). You friend the person you're playing, play your games, winner reports back. A lot of it is on you to find your opponent, be signed in, etc. Repeat till finals.

Edited that into the original post. This is basically how most HS tournaments work right now. Teamliquid's site has all their brackets/check-in stuff built-in, as does MLG, and most of the other small tournaments just use websites that have bracket/check-in functions. So if you want to play HS competitively this is what you'll be doing a lot.
